Step 1: Understand the Basics of Ethereum and ERC Standards
Ethereum is a blockchain platform that supports smart contracts, enabling developers to create decentralized applications and tokens. Most Ethereum-based tokens adhere to specific technical standards, the most popular being:- ERC-20: For fungible tokens like cryptocurrencies.
- ERC-721: For non-fungible tokens (NFTs).
- ERC-1155: A multi-standard for both fungible and non-fungible tokens.

Step 3: Write and Deploy the Smart Contract
Smart contracts are self-executing codes that define your token’s behavior on the blockchain. Here’s how to get started:- Set Up a Development Environment Install tools like Remix (an online Solidity IDE) or use frameworks like Hardhat or Truffle. You’ll also need MetaMask for managing your Ethereum account and deploying the contract.
- Code Your Token Contract
Use Solidity, Ethereum’s native programming language, to write the contract. For an ERC-20 token, you can use the OpenZeppelin library to simplify the process. Here’s a basic example:
solidity
import “@openzeppelin/contracts/token/ERC20/ERC20.sol”;// SPDX-License-Identifier: MIT pragma solidity ^0.8.0;
contract MyToken is ERC20 { constructor(uint256 initialSupply) ERC20(“MyToken”, “MTK”) { _mint(msg.sender, initialSupply); } } - Test Your Contract Test the smart contract using tools like Remix or Hardhat to ensure it functions as intended.
- Deploy to the Ethereum Blockchain After testing, deploy the contract on Ethereum. If you’re concerned about gas fees on the mainnet, consider testing on a testnet like Goerli or Sepolia first.
Step 4: Verify and Publish Your Token
Once deployed, verify your contract on Etherscan (Ethereum’s block explorer) by submitting the source code. This step increases transparency and trust among potential users.Step 5: Distribute and Launch

How to Optimize Gas Fees During Deployment
Deploying a token on the Ethereum mainnet can be expensive due to fluctuating gas fees. Here are some strategies to reduce costs:- Optimize Your Smart Contract Code Efficient code reduces the gas required to execute functions. Use tools like Solidity Gas Reporter to identify inefficiencies.
- Deploy During Low Network Congestion Gas fees vary depending on network activity. Use services like ETH Gas Station to track congestion and deploy during off-peak hours.
- Consider Layer 2 Solutions Platforms like Arbitrum, Optimism, or zkSync provide cost-efficient alternatives to deploying on Ethereum’s mainnet while maintaining security and compatibility.

How to Test Your Token Before Launching
Before deploying your token on the Ethereum mainnet, thorough testing is critical to ensure it functions as intended and is free from vulnerabilities. Here’s how you can test effectively:- Use Ethereum Testnets Ethereum provides several testnets like Goerli, Sepolia, and Rinkeby where you can deploy and interact with your token without incurring real costs. These testnets simulate the mainnet environment.
- Simulate Real-World Scenarios Test scenarios such as high transaction volumes, token transfers, and edge cases to ensure the token performs under all conditions.
- Fuzz Testing Use automated tools to test your smart contract against random and unexpected inputs, helping to uncover edge-case vulnerabilities.
- Bug Bounty Programs Invite external developers to test your token and report potential issues. Offering rewards can incentivize deeper testing and improve security.
Legal Considerations for Token Creation
Launching a token involves navigating complex legal and regulatory frameworks. Here’s what you need to consider:- Determine Token Classification
- Utility Tokens: Used within a specific ecosystem and generally not considered securities.
- Security Tokens: Represent investment contracts and are subject to securities regulations.
- Comply With Local Laws Regulations vary by region. Research the laws in your country to ensure compliance. For example, in the U.S., the SEC has strict guidelines for security tokens.
- Include Proper Disclaimers Publish clear disclaimers on your website and whitepaper to inform users of risks and responsibilities.
- Draft Terms and Conditions Provide a legal framework for your token, covering ownership, usage, and dispute resolution.
How to List Your Token on Decentralized Exchanges (DEXs)
Getting your token listed on popular decentralized exchanges (DEXs) like Uniswap or SushiSwap increases visibility and trading opportunities. Here’s how to do it:- Create a Liquidity Pool Pair your token with a base cryptocurrency (like ETH or USDT) to create a liquidity pool. This enables users to trade your token on the platform.
- Provide Initial Liquidity Deposit a substantial amount of tokens and the paired cryptocurrency to ensure smooth trading and reduce slippage.
- Promote the Token Pair Share the pool’s address with your community and encourage liquidity providers to join by offering rewards like yield farming incentives.
- Monitor Pool Performance Regularly track metrics like trading volume and liquidity levels to optimize the pool’s performance.

What Is Gas Optimization and Why Is It Important?
Gas optimization refers to writing efficient smart contract code to minimize gas fees during transactions. High gas fees can deter users from interacting with your token. Tips for Gas Optimization:- Use Efficient Data Structures: Avoid excessive storage operations by using mappings or arrays wisely.
- Batch Transactions: Combine multiple operations into a single function call to save gas.
- Leverage Libraries: Use pre-tested libraries like OpenZeppelin for optimized implementations of common token standards.
- Audit Your Code: Use tools like MythX or Slither to detect and resolve inefficiencies in your smart contract.

How to Create a Governance Framework for Decentralized Projects
If your token is part of a decentralized autonomous organization (DAO), a robust governance framework is critical to ensuring effective decision-making and long-term growth.- Define Voting Mechanisms
- Token-Weighted Voting: Votes are proportional to the number of tokens held.
- Quadratic Voting: Reduces the influence of large token holders by weighting votes logarithmically.
- Establish Proposals and Timelines Clearly define how proposals are submitted, reviewed, and executed. Include timelines for voting and implementation.
- Implement On-Chain Tools Use governance platforms like Snapshot or Tally to facilitate transparent and tamper-proof voting.
- Encourage Community Participation Educate token holders about governance processes and incentivize participation through rewards or recognition.
The Role of Token Burn Mechanisms
Token burning permanently removes tokens from circulation, creating scarcity and potentially increasing value. Here’s how you can implement token burns effectively:- Manual Token Burns Periodically burn tokens based on milestones or revenue, which can boost investor confidence.
- Automatic Burn Mechanisms Code your token to burn a small percentage during every transaction or specific use case, like staking rewards.
- Buyback and Burn Allocate a portion of project revenue to repurchase tokens from the market and burn them, reducing supply and rewarding holders.
- Communicate the Impact Transparently share details about the burn mechanism and its impact on token supply and value to build trust.

1. What is the cost of creating a token on Ethereum?
The cost of creating a token on Ethereum varies depending on gas fees at the time of deployment and the complexity of your smart contract. On average, it can range from $50 to $500 or more. You can reduce costs by deploying during low network congestion or using Layer 2 solutions.
2. Can I create an Ethereum token without coding skills?
Yes, you can create a token without coding skills using tools like TokenMint, Moralis, or Remix with OpenZeppelin templates. These platforms provide user-friendly interfaces and pre-built contracts, making it easy to deploy a token.
3. How do I ensure my token is secure after launch?
To ensure your token’s security, conduct thorough audits using services like CertiK or Trail of Bits, follow best practices for smart contract development, and regularly monitor and update your code to address vulnerabilities.
